The global automated feeding systems market is forecasted to grow by USD 5712.2 mn during 2025-2030, accelerating at a CAGR of 10.8% during the forecast period. The report on the global automated feeding systems market provides a holistic analysis, market size and forecast, trends, growth drivers, and challenges, as well as vendor analysis covering around 25 vendors.
The report offers an up-to-date analysis regarding the current market scenario, the latest trends and drivers, and the overall market environment. The market is driven by technological integration through advanced digital connectivity, precision nutrition and sustainable waste reduction, expansion of intensive livestock farming infrastructure.

This study identifies the accelerated adoption of automated systems to offset labor volatility as one of the prime reasons driving the global automated feeding systems market growth during the next few years. Also, rise of precision livestock farming and increasing demand for sustainable agriculture will lead to sizable demand in the market.
